Output 43428e6635a392fd551c22b032eb8d7ba95ab488c2b0def04b189eb52b7f53c0:4

value
95190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f2ce1e93fedb3c2f6444a07ca45813fde74e8c OP_EQUAL
address
36t8dgddtSEqrBpALxSJfowUTPkktr4R5L
transaction
43428e6635a392fd551c22b032eb8d7ba95ab488c2b0def04b189eb52b7f53c0
spent
true